Quick Summary
The U.S. Air Force is conducting a Sources Sought inquiry, which includes a Request for Quote (RFQ), for the purchase of NFPA 1961 rated structural Fire Hoses for RAF Alconbury. This effort aims to identify capable vendors and gather pricing information for specific hose requirements. Responses are due by February 27, 2026.
Scope of Work
This opportunity seeks to procure various types of replacement fire hoses, including:
- HYFLOW, 4" X 50', YELLOW, COUPLED STORZ (Quantity: 20)
- TRU-175, 1 3/4" X 50', YELLOW, COUPLED NH THREADS (Quantity: 15)
- TRU-175, 1 3/4" X 50', RED, COUPLED NH THREADS (Quantity: 15)
- ECO-10, 3" X 50', RED, COUPLED NH THREADS (Quantity: 20)
Bidders are required to provide a line item for shipping costs.
